The wine is produced by Róisín Curley, an Irish Master of Wine who launched her micro-négociant project in Burgundy. She sources small parcels of grapes from growers who mostly farm organically. Her approach is low intervention, minimal additions, careful sorting and gentle handling allowing the character of the terroir to shine through. The grapes for this Bouzeron come from Burgundy’s only appellation devoted to the native white variety Aligoté, from modest vineyards tended by growers committed to sustainable viticulture.

The 2023 Bouzeron is 100% Aligoté. The wine is crafted with a subtle and restrained winemaking approach, fermentation in neutral vessels, light handling, little or no new oak, to preserve freshness and reflect terroir. Expect crisp citrus, green apple and white flower aromas, with a lean, mineral driven palate and lively acidity. This wine suits well chilled seafood such as oysters or scallops, shellfish, trout, or fresh goat cheese. Simple, pure dishes that echo the wine’s clarity and finesse.
